学习进度条

学习进度条

周次

学习时间

新编写代码行数

博客量(篇)

学到知识点

     

第一周

160

0

1

github的使用和认识软件工程这门课的价值。

第二周

160

130

3

复利的计算和Github的一些简单操作还有就是进行项目的开发分析,还有就是对复利的更新。

第三周

   220

100 

 3

 在课上学到了各种主流的软件开发方法,如瀑布模型,圆形开发模型,螺旋模型。还有这些开发流程的特点。明白了正确的开发方法是一个好的程序员所必须掌握的。

还有就是对复利计算器的功能添加,和扩展,熟悉实际工作中的开发流程。

第四周

   160

 300左右

    4

 学习了单元测试的作用,还有就是教了我们如何在JAVA上写单元测试,测试写出来的代码,这样对我们的后期写程序有很大的帮助,当我们写的程序变得大时就,就可以方便利的测试出BUG。还有就是在GITHUB上的团队合作,为我之后的团队合的协同和版本的控制非常有利。

第五周

260

(包括课外)

  1000左右

 现在我已经能很好的用JUint进行单元测试了,可以用这种方法找到程序的bug,并进行修复。

在课堂中则了解到:

1.团队开发的作用,结对开发是可以很好的提高开发的效率和质量。

2.了解到要进行好的结对开发的话就要良好的沟通,并且还要有好的编码习惯,写的代码要易于阅读,逻辑清晰,是队友可以看懂,以便提高效率。

第六周

   

320

(包括完成作业用时)

   200左右   3

 通过结对合作,我和他人在开发上的交流能力在提升,和他人沟通的技巧在熟练。在项目的估计上也越发的精确了,现在估时的误差不再像以前一样过长了,这是对自身能力的认识的体现,可能是最近对作业的修改和开发的时间要求变短了,所以有一种压力推动自己加快脚步。

还学会了在C/S的Java程序上应用JDBC,链接MYSQL数据库,并进行管理。

第七周

    160  300左右  2

通过结对合作,我学会了合作是一种分工明确的一种开发软件的模式,需要我们的相互理解与相互支持。但是合作不是一朝一夕就可以很好的,还是要多合作多练习才可以变得更好的。因为以后还要和其他队合作的。

 第八周     320左右   400   2

 通过结成更大的团队,我觉的这样工作起来的时间变短,效率说不上有多大的提高,但是个人用时是减少了的,因为开发时有人帮忙查资料,共同讨论,帮忙审阅,这的确给我提供了不少帮助的。

而且这周花了两天还是把android的入门大致的了解了一点了,基本已经可以自己独自写一些不成体系的小android程序了,我自己都不敢说是app啊,但是别人的app还是可以基本看懂的,知道他们写的app代码的作用。最大的收获是学到了~靠~自~己。

 第九周     220   400左右   3

 这一周主要是忙于自学android,为了更深入的熟悉和了解android花费了不少时间,所以在其他的一些方面自然是少了一点精力去深入了,但是我自己觉得是值得的,是有收获的。最起码我的时间是用在了做自己想做的的事情上了,因为我觉得不能跟着别人的步伐,要有自己的主张。

在确立了这个四人小分队后,还分好了个人的角色,使得队友们都可以各司其职,各展所长,这使得队友们可以更适应团队的合作。

 第十周      220      300        2 

在这一周课堂上并没有什么特别有用的知识讲授,主要还是自己学习android,还有JSP的开发知识,还有技巧。小组确定项目后,就有东西可以做了,但是还不知道这个项目是不是就是最终要进行的,还是需要进行调查和可行性分析。

觉得学android的话看mars的视频是很有帮助的,讲的很生动而且比较透彻,会把知识点进行串联讲解非常的易懂很适合初学者。 

  第十一周    360       600        2

在这周我们小组就进行了几次会议,确定了接下来的项目的工作流程还有就是任务的分配,确定了具体的版面的大概功能还有就是大概的设计思路,但是有一些地方还是没能讨论出一个具体的解决方案来,还是要在下周才能有一个具体计划。项目进度进展正常。

第十二周           220        500  2

1.学会简单连接MYSQL;

2.学会JSP+mysql数据库操作 查询例子;

第十三周    220    700     2

这周我们通过过了几次讨论确定了如何继续接下来的项目,好有学习了android的其他知识点,还有通过做数据库的大作业我对于JSP的MVC开发模式有了很大的提高,还熟悉了JSP的开发技巧。

第十四周    100    900  2

这周我在做数据库的大作业和图形学的大作业,所以我觉得并没有做什么有用的东西。

第十五周     100    800  2这周数据库大作业已经成功完成,但是图形学还是在做,JSP的大作业也开始了,所以就没什么时间了。
    

第十六周     100    500     2   

这周由于一栋全体停网所以只能手机上更新了,而这个星期我就继续完善项目,美化界面,并添加功能。

 

posted on 2016-03-09 22:53 liezh 阅读(...) 评论(...) 编辑 收藏

转载于:https://www.cnblogs.com/liezhihua/p/5260118.html

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/373485.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

ARM基础

1.  将32位a的【7&#xff1a;4】改成0101 -> a a&(~(0xF << 4)) | (0x5 << 4)&#xff1b; 2.  32位&#xff1a;单次处理数据32位。 3.  对于CPU而言&#xff0c;一切皆内存&#xff1b; 4.  DMA总线&#xff1a;不经过CPU直接在内存和内存间交换…

使用Jolokia和JMX进行客户端服务器监视

Java监视工具的选择非常广泛&#xff08;由Google提供的随机选择和顺序&#xff09;&#xff1a; javamelody 压力探头 JVisualVM 控制台 贾蒙 Java JMX Nagios插件不适用 此外&#xff0c;还有各种专用工具&#xff0c;例如ActiveMQ &#xff0c; JBoss &#xff0c; Qu…

图书管理系统数据字典_2. 结构化——数据字典

返回目录&#xff1a;Chilan Yuk&#xff1a;软件工程分析设计图库目录​zhuanlan.zhihu.com一、基本知识用于定义数据流和数据存储的结构&#xff0c;并给出构成所给的数据流和数据存储的各数据项的基本数据类型。数据字典中应该包括关于数据的如下信息一般信息&#xff08;名…

HDOJ 5184 Brackets 卡特兰数扩展

既求从点(0,0)仅仅能向上或者向右而且不穿越yx到达点(a,b)有多少总走法... 有公式: C(ab,min(a,b))-C(ab,min(a,b)-1) /// 折纸法证明卡特兰数: http://blog.sina.com.cn/s/blog_6917f47301010cno.html Brackets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65…

010-python基础-数据类型-字符串操作

1、移除空白 1 username.strip() 2、分割 1 names "alex,jack,rain" 2 names_1 names.split(",") #  字符串分割之后变成列表 3 print(names_1) 4 #输出 5 [alex, jack, rain] 3、合并列表各元素成为字符串 1 names_1 [alex, jack, rain]2 names_2…

重复次数最多的 子串_每日算法系列【LeetCode 424】替换后的最长重复字符

题目描述给你一个仅由大写英文字母组成的字符串&#xff0c;你可以将任意位置上的字符替换成另外的字符&#xff0c;总共可最多替换 k 次。在执行上述操作后&#xff0c;找到包含重复字母的最长子串的长度。示例1输入&#xff1a; s "ABAB", k 2 输出&#xff1a; …

python基础(一)简单入门

一.第一个python程序 1.交互式编程 直接在命令行里面输入python即可进入python交互式命令行&#xff0c;linux下一样&#xff1a; 在 python 提示符中输入以下文本信息&#xff0c;然后按 Enter 键查看运行效果&#xff1a; 2.脚本式编程 把代码都写到文件里面&#xff0c;然后…

VS2015 python

http://pgqlife.info/2015/05/05/VS-Python/ 配置文档转载于:https://www.cnblogs.com/itdef/p/5262712.html

了解Java弱引用

我最近没来得及关注该博客&#xff0c;最重要的是&#xff0c;我没有为与技术界的所有人保持联系而致歉。 我最近偶然发现了Java 1.2以来提供的java.lang.ref包&#xff0c;但具有讽刺意味的是&#xff0c;几天前我才知道它。 在浏览了几篇有关各种引用类型和java doc的文章时&…

unbuntu 启动任务脚本_Ubuntu下服务启动脚本编写

像Nginx、MySQL等服务一样&#xff0c;在后台运行自己编写的抓取天气信息的Python脚本。1.以管理员权限新建一个服务脚本文件sudo vim /etc/init.d/weather_service2.用下列模板修改该服务脚本文件#!/bin/bash### BEGIN INIT INFO## Provides: weather_service# Required-Start…

iOS开发工具——网络封包分析工具Charles

作者 唐巧 发布于 2013年12月9日 | 1 讨论 分享到&#xff1a;微博微信FacebookTwitter有道云笔记邮件分享稍后阅读我的阅读清单简介 Charles是在Mac下常用的截取网络封包的工具&#xff0c;在做iOS开发时&#xff0c;我们为了调试与服务器端的网络通讯协议&#xff0c;常常需要…

Java Web托管选项流程图

我经常被问到的一个问题是在何处以及如何托管Java Web应用程序。 可以在带有嵌入式服务器的Eclipse中创建它很好&#xff0c;但是如何将它带给人们呢&#xff1f; 长期以来&#xff0c;对于发烧友的程序员一直没有答案。 只有昂贵和超大型的选择。 事情最近变了&#xff0c;但这…

查找出系统中大于50k 且小于100k 的文件并删除。

查找出系统中大于50k 且小于100k 的文件并删除。 [rootxusx xxx]# ll -lhtotal 624K-rw-r--r-- 1 root root 576K Nov 30 21:39 1.txt-rw-r--r-- 1 root root 48K Nov 30 21:40 2.txt [rootxusx xxx]# find ./ -type f -size 1k -a -size -100k ./2.txt 转载于:https://www.cnb…

vb.net mysql存储图片_怎么让VB.NET 上传图片到SQL 数据库只保存路径,图片保存到文件...

我的前台代码dimCoonAsSqlClient.SqlConnectiondimRsAsNewSqlClient.SqlCommandRs.ConnectionCoonRsNewSqlClient.SqlCommand("上传图片",Coon)Rs.CommandTypeCommandType.StoredPr...我的前台代码 dim Coon As SqlClient.SqlConnection dim Rs As New SqlClient.Sql…

[国嵌攻略][132][串口驱动实现]

如何开发Linux驱动程序 一般情况下都会有现成的驱动程序&#xff0c;不需要从零开始开发驱动程序。所以Linux驱动开发主要分为两个步骤&#xff1a;1.读得懂驱动程序&#xff1b;2.写的了核心功能。 发送中断处理程序 发送中断处理函数在/drivers/serial/samsung.c的s3c24xx_se…

使用Regions ADF 11g进行Master Detail CRUD操作

你好 此示例演示了如何使用Regions在表之间创建Master Detail关系。 区域的主要目的是可重用性的概念。 使用区域和有限的任务流&#xff0c;我们可以将页面重用到许多其他页面中&#xff0c;以保持相同的功能并采用更简洁的方法。 下载示例应用程序。 在此示例中&#xff0c;…

[转] vim自定义配置 和 在ubnetu中安装vim

Ubuntu 12.04安装vim和配置 问题&#xff1a; ubuntu默认没有安装vim&#xff0c;出现&#xff1a; jygubuntu:~$ vim test.cThe program vim can be found in the following packages: * vim * vim-gnome * vim-tiny * vim-athena * vim-gtk * vim-noxTry: sudo apt-get insta…

win7 mysql php apache myadmin_windows下Apache+mysql+php+phpMyAdmin的安装及配置 | 学步园

1、下载Apache ( httpd-2.2.25-win32-x86-no_ssl.msi )http://httpd.apache.org/download.cgi#apache24根据提示安装到路径(建议自定义路径)&#xff0c;NetWork Domain和Server Name都输入 localhost(访问时使用的域名);2、下载mysql (mysql-5.5.34-win32.msi )http://dev.m…

(15) PHP 随笔---LAMP Linux基本操作 对文件、目录的操作

◇对目录的操作&#xff1a; ◇创建目录&#xff1a; mkdir Xmu //在当前目录下创建一个名为Xmu的目录 ◇创建多个级别目录关系&#xff1a; mkdir -p newdir/newdir/newdir //在当前目录下创建多个连续目录&#xff0c;-p的意思是以递归的方式 ◇移动目录(也可以针对…

具有NetBeans,嵌入式GlassFish,JPA和MySQL数据源的Arquillian

这是一个偶然的帖子。 我一直在研究交易CDI观察者&#xff0c;并尝试使用嵌入式GlassFish对它进行一些集成测试。 但是令人惊讶的是&#xff0c;这种方法不能很好地工作&#xff0c;我仍在弄清楚&#xff0c;使用普通的嵌入式GlassFish时问题出在哪里。 同时&#xff0c;我转到…